Why Dust Comes Back So Quickly
Many people think dust only comes from outside, open windows, or daily activity inside the home. While these can all contribute to dust, the HVAC system may also play a role.
When dust and debris build up inside the ducts, the system can push particles back into the rooms every time it runs. This may make your home feel dusty even shortly after cleaning.
If you notice dust collecting around vents, on shelves, near return air grilles, or on floors soon after vacuuming, it may be time to inspect your air duct system.
Common Signs Your Air Ducts May Need Cleaning
Homeowners often begin looking for Air Duct Cleaning Near Me in Vienna VA after noticing one or more clear warning signs.
One sign is visible dust around the air vents. If the area near your registers looks dirty, or if dark marks appear around the vent openings, there may be buildup inside the system.
Another sign is weak airflow. If some rooms feel less comfortable than others, or if the HVAC system seems to run longer than usual, the ducts may need attention.
Musty or stale odors can also come from dirty ducts. When dust, pet hair, moisture, or other debris collect inside the system, unpleasant smells may spread through the home when the air turns on.
Air duct cleaning may also be helpful after renovations, construction, flooring installation, drywall work, or moving into a home that has not been professionally cleaned in years.

What Should Be Included in Professional Air Duct Cleaning?
A proper air duct cleaning service should include more than wiping the outside of the vent covers.
Professional technicians should inspect the system, clean supply vents, clean return vents, clean registers, and remove dust and debris from accessible ductwork. The goal is to clean the air pathway, not just the visible parts of the system.
Before booking, homeowners should ask what is included in the service. A reliable company should clearly explain whether they clean the full accessible duct system, what equipment they use, and how the process works.
If a company only cleans the vent covers, that is not enough to address buildup inside the air ducts.

Air Duct Cleaning After Renovation or Remodeling
Renovation dust is one of the most common reasons homeowners schedule air duct cleaning.
Even when a contractor cleans the visible surfaces, fine dust from drywall, wood, flooring, paint, or construction work can enter the HVAC system. Once inside the ductwork, these particles may continue to circulate through the home long after the project is finished.
If you recently remodeled your kitchen, finished a basement, replaced floors, painted rooms, or completed any construction work, professional air duct cleaning can help remove hidden dust from the system.

How Often Should Homeowners Clean Air Ducts?
There is no single answer for every home. The right timing depends on several factors, including pets, allergies, dust levels, renovation work, HVAC usage, and the age of the home.
Homeowners may want to schedule air duct cleaning if they notice visible dust, odors from the vents, weak airflow, recent construction, or if the system has not been cleaned in several years.
